A Countryside Gem in Pett
Nestled in the serene village of Pett, surrounded by lush green fields and woodlands, and just a short drive from the beach, this pub/BNB offers an unparalleled escape from the hustle and bustle of daily life. The location itself is picturesque, but it's the amenities and service that truly stand out.
Parking is never a concern with their spacious lot, a boon for anyone who's faced the woes of limited parking in popular destinations. The expansive outside area, with its meticulously maintained grounds, provides ample seating options for guests looking to drink in the fresh air and idyllic views.
The building, a historic structure from the 1600s, exudes charm and character, giving guests a delightful sense of stepping back in time. Inside, the bar area buzzes with locals, eager to share stories and insights about the area, making it a hub of local culture and camaraderie.
The in-house restaurant is another feather in the cap for this establishment. On my visit, I indulged in a fish dish from the specials menu. Perfectly cooked to have a crispy skin, yet maintaining a tender and fluffy interior, it was a testament to the chef's skills. The following day's full English breakfast, complete with locally sourced sausages from a nearby butcher, was generous in portion and rich in flavor.
But the pièce de résistance of our culinary experience was the roast dinner. As we awaited our order, the air was filled with rave reviews from fellow diners, amplifying our anticipation. We weren't disappointed. Even at the last sitting, the freshness of the food was evident, with vegetables cooked to perfection and meat that melted in the mouth. The portions were generous, and the taste? Simply the best roast I've had in ages.
In conclusion, if you find yourself in Pett and are looking for a place that combines history, hospitality, and haute cuisine, look no further. This pub/BNB is truly a countryside gem.
